About

The Goodlettsville Chamber Foundation, Inc. is a 501(c) (3) non-profit organization with a board of directors established according to the Foundation’s bylaws. The board has no employees. The Goodlettsville Area Chamber of Commerce provides staff support for general administration, financial accounting services and fundraising at no cost to the Foundation.

Purpose

The purpose of the Goodlettsville Chamber Foundation is the promotion of social welfare by advancing the educational, civic, economic and cultural interests of the city of Goodlettsville. The objective is to promote the growth of the city by developing leadership with a dynamic and innovative vision for the future; linking the business community in partnership with educational, governmental and non-profit organizations; and serving as a vehicle for research, planning and community education.

Eligibility

Applicants must:
• Be a 501(c)(3) nonprofit or public entity (e.g., school or library)
• Operate programs or services in Goodlettsville, TN
• Offer non-discriminatory, publicly accessible services
• Chamber membership encouraged, but not required
• Prior recipients are encouraged to apply again

We do not fund:
• Political or partisan efforts
• Religious activities
• Individuals
